HOPKINS, THE WHITE HOUSE Subject: Transmittal of Cable from Embassy, Vienna Ambassador Donnelly has asked that the President be informed of the contents of the attached cable (Embassy telegram 3763, June 1) which explains the reasons for the Ambassador's veto of an Austrian law regarding amnesty for former Nazis. As a result of this veto the League of Independents, a minority Austrian party, has sent a telegram to the President requesting the recall of the Ambassador. appedited McWilliams Director, Executive Secretariat Enclosure: DECLASSIFIED Telegram from Vienna 3763 of June 1, 1952.
